Accountant Jobs in UAE (Vacancies)

Accounting professionals play an integral role in almost all businesses and government agencies. Accounting roles encompass a wide range of job functions that generally revolve around reviewing financial operations and making recommendations to the management on methods of reducing operational costs while increasing revenue and profits. Some of the typical duties performed by accountants include creating sales and cash flow reports, keeping balance sheets, carrying out billing activities, administering payroll, managing budgets, and maintaining an inventory. Accounting as a career is a varied field with numerous career paths to choose from including:

  • Financial Accounting
  • Management Accounting
  • Financial planning
  • Income tax planning, advising and reporting
  • Accounting Systems Consultancy
  • Auditing

Accounting Jobs in UAE come with promising benefits and lucrative tax-free salary packages. Generally, the salary varies depending on the field of accounting. For instance, in both Dubai and Abu Dhabi, risk management professionals are paid better compared to general management, info systems, internal audit, and government accounting. Valid qualifications and experience are a necessity to practice accounting in the UAE. Generally, a bachelor’s degree in accounting and the status of a certified public accountant (CPA) are a prerequisite in this field. In some cases, especially senior or managerial positions, professional experience is also required. Working knowledge of accounting software such as Microsoft Excel and QuickBooks is also necessary. Moreover, although English is the official language for business, it is advantageous to possess a working knowledge of the Arabic language, since some companies convey official messages in Arabic.

Foreigners are expected to secure a residency visa and work permit to be able to work and live in the country. In most cases, the employer is responsible for the visa application process and applies on behalf of employees. Upon securing a job in the UAE, you can expect to work for a maximum of 8 hours per day, which is 48 hours per week. Friday is the official day off, but in some organizations, Saturday is also an off day. Moreover, during the Ramadan period, working hours are usually reduced to six hours per day. Additionally, all employees are entitled to enjoy a day off on public holidays.
